What Altus Power does

Altus Power, Inc., headquartered in Stamford, Connecticut, is a prominent provider of sustainable energy solutions operating throughout the United States. Established in 2009, the company is actively engaged in developing and managing a comprehensive suite of clean electrification initiatives. These include deploying on-site solar power generation for businesses, industrial facilities, and public sector organizations, as well as fostering community solar programs, integrating energy storage systems, and building out electric vehicle charging infrastructure.
